As shown in FIGS. 1-4, the application provides an all-round sprinkling connector in gardens, including sprinkling connector's base 1, place sprinkling connector in the ground of required watering through base 1, connect chamber 11 is installed to base 1's upper end, connects chamber 11 through the setting and is used for the weight that increases base 1, improves base 1's stability, connects one side of chamber 11 and has seted up water inlet 12, with water piping connection to water inlet 12 department, to connecting chamber 11 and adding the water of required irrigation.
The lower end of the base 1 is further provided with a fixing member (not shown), the fixing member can be detached, and it can be understood that when the stability of the base 1 is poor, the fixing member can be installed at the lower end of the base 1 and inserted into the ground to be irrigated, so that the stability of the base 1 is ensured.
The upper end fixed mounting who connects chamber 11 has bracing piece 13, and the upper end swing joint of bracing piece 13 has sprays a 2, and it can be understood that bracing piece 13 is inside to be provided with the inner tube to will spray 2 and be connected the pipe connection between the chamber 11, the outside pipe connection who sprays 2 has connecting pipe 21, the outside pipe connection of connecting pipe 21 has outlet pipe 22.
In this embodiment, an impeller (not shown) is disposed at the connection position of the support rod 13 and the connection cavity 11, and the impeller is a conventional impeller, and when water is sprayed outwards through the water outlet pipe 22, the impeller is driven to rotate, so that the spraying member 2 rotates at a constant speed during the spraying process.
One end of the water outlet pipe 22, which is far away from the spraying part 2, is provided with a water outlet 23, as shown in fig. 4, the water outlet 23 is obliquely arranged, so that the spraying part 2 is conveniently driven to rotate, and a sealing plug 24 is arranged at the water outlet 23 to seal the water outlet pipe 22.
The first embodiment is as follows: connect raceway 12 departments to water inlet for rivers flow to the interior entering of joint chamber 11 through water pressure, outwards spray through outlet pipe 22, and rivers drive when spraying and spray 2 at the in-process at the uniform velocity rotation of spraying, thereby rotate to the landscape plant of farther department and spray.
As shown in fig. 3, a threaded groove 25 is disposed at one end of the water outlet pipe 22 close to the connection pipe 21, a plurality of groups of holes 26 are disposed above the water outlet pipe 22, a sealing shell 27 is sleeved outside the water outlet pipe 22, the sealing shell 27 is in threaded connection with the threaded groove 25, and a connection portion between the sealing shell 27 and the threaded groove 25 is made of rubber, so that the sealing shell 27 ensures the connection tightness when in connection.
In the present embodiment, as shown in fig. 3, a hole is opened at an end of the sealing shell 27 far away from the connecting pipe 21, and the diameter of the hole is the same as that of the water outlet 23, and it can be understood that the sealing plug 24 can be plugged into the sealing shell 27 and the water outlet 23 at the same time to ensure the sealing thereof.
A handle 28 is fixedly mounted to the outer end of the sealing plug 24 to facilitate mounting or dismounting of the sealing plug 24.
Example two: before spraying, the sealing shell 27 is removed, after the removal, the sealing plug 24 is plugged into the water outlet pipe 22 to block the water outlet 23, at the moment, water cannot be sprayed outwards through the water outlet 23, so that the water is sprayed outwards through the hole 26 on the water outlet pipe 22, and then is sprayed to garden plants near the joint.
Example three: dismantle simultaneously sealed shell 27 and sealing plug 24 in the lump before spraying, rivers at this moment outwards spray through delivery port 23 and hole 26 simultaneously to the landscape plant who locates far away and near with the joint rotates simultaneously and sprays, improves and sprays efficiency, realizes the all-round effect of spraying.
